Transaction ef8ef1229649291687da1ba1ca2673ae3bf3c33c6121a2e4fdb808e55e72b4e8
1 Input
1 Output
-
ef8ef1229649291687da1ba1ca2673ae3bf3c33c6121a2e4fdb808e55e72b4e8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 74944843f9780f8c0e20ee841b28853de365c4297c5fc1fc494aa5c408b48b87
- address
- bc1pwj2yssle0q8ccr3qa6zpk2y98h3kt3pf030urlzff2jugz953wrs8e3k2h